Don't set the font name here, leave that to themes, fixes #387508.
authorRichard Hult <richard@imendio.com>
Sat, 10 Mar 2007 20:50:58 +0000 (20:50 +0000)
committerRichard Hult <rhult@src.gnome.org>
Sat, 10 Mar 2007 20:50:58 +0000 (20:50 +0000)
2007-03-10  Richard Hult  <richard@imendio.com>

* gdk/quartz/gdkevents-quartz.c: (gdk_screen_get_setting): Don't set
the font name here, leave that to themes, fixes #387508.

svn path=/trunk/; revision=17459

ChangeLog
gdk/quartz/gdkevents-quartz.c

index 1f687e40f86d5055feac1a82a18736b4d6bbb0e1..5736d5e1f60eebc21b683b0186a0d34b20970a68 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,8 @@
+2007-03-10  Richard Hult  <richard@imendio.com>
+
+       * gdk/quartz/gdkevents-quartz.c: (gdk_screen_get_setting): Don't set
+       the font name here, leave that to themes, fixes #387508.
+
 2007-03-10  Kristian Rietveld  <kris@gtk.org>
 
        * gtk/gtktreemodelsort.c (gtk_tree_model_sort_ref_node),
index 8fcae5956b9ffc9ebddf64cdb30933b72a3b1e07..7e4fd3f6e7711fb6aa15264ea187a71bd92620ff 100644 (file)
@@ -1370,16 +1370,7 @@ gdk_screen_get_setting (GdkScreen   *screen,
                        const gchar *name,
                        GValue      *value)
 {
-  /* FIXME: This should be fetched from the correct preference value. See:
-     http://developer.apple.com/documentation/UserExperience/\
-     Conceptual/OSXHIGuidelines/XHIGText/chapter_13_section_2.html
-  */
-  if (strcmp (name, "gtk-font-name") == 0)
-    {
-      g_value_set_string (value, "Lucida Grande 12");
-      return TRUE;
-    }
-  else if (strcmp (name, "gtk-double-click-time") == 0)
+  if (strcmp (name, "gtk-double-click-time") == 0)
     {
       NSUserDefaults *defaults = [NSUserDefaults standardUserDefaults];
       float t;